5.1 Memories Used for CPU Module
5.1.6 Memory card
(b) Writing to the Flash card
The following two methods are available.
Writing by "Write the program memory to ROM" ( Section 5.1.7(1)(a))
Writing by "Write to PLC (Flash ROM)” ( Section 5.1.7(1)(b))
The file size has its minimum unit. ( Section 5.3.4)
The occupied memory capacity may be greater than the actual file size.
Note that as the number of files increases, the difference between the occupied memory capacity and the
actual file size increases.
